Rising interest rates

The Bank of England’s base rate hikes have made mortgages significantly more expensive, putting homeownership out of reach for many buyers, especially first-time buyers and those needing larger loans. This has drastically reduced the pool of potential buyers, meaning properties sit on the market longer.

Cost of living pressure

With rising costs for essentials like energy, groceries, and fuel, many people are struggling to save for deposits or afford more expensive homes. This has caused a sharp drop in demand across the housing market.

Affordability issues

According to The Times, house prices in Manchester have skyrocketed, far outpacing wage growth. In 2025, the average property costs 5.9 times the typical household income, compared to 3.6 times in 2000. For many buyers, this makes securing a mortgage nearly impossible.

Legislative changes 

New policies, like Labour’s Renters’ Rights Bill, have pushed many landlords out of the rental market due to higher taxes, increased interest rates, and stricter tenancy laws. This has led to an oversupply of flats and fewer investors looking to buy.
